Gold Prices Rise as Market Anticipates Record Highs
Gold prices hover near $2,790, driven by a weaker dollar compounded with uncertainties surrounding trade tariffs. The market is buzzing with speculation over whether this surge could push gold to reach record highs. As global economic factors intertwine, investors remain keenly interested in the precious metal. Analysts emphasize the advantages of holding gold as a hedge against inflation and economic instability. The threat of tariffs adds to volatility in the marketplace, positioning gold as a safe haven for investors.
